Food Represents 16% in the Cost of Raising a Child

2013-08-19 23:08:00| National Hog Farmer

By P. Scott Shearer, Bockorny Group, Washington, DC USDAs latest Expenditures on Children by Families annual report indicates that a middle-income family with a child born in 2012 will spend more than $240,000 for food, shelter and other child-rearing expenses until the child is 18 years old. read more
